The Core Idea – Environmental Compliance

Environmental compliance and regulatory compliance are crucial for organizations to operate sustainably and legally. It involves adhering to environmental regulations and standards set by government agencies.

Environmental compliance utilizes AI and automated systems to ensure organizations meet ecological requirements and benchmarks effectively. This is critical for protecting the environment, avoiding fines, and maintaining a strong reputation.

Waste Tracking – Monitoring & Reporting

Compliance Reporting: Regularly generating reports demonstrating adherence to environmental regulations is key.

Automated systems track waste streams, monitor emissions, and generate the necessary documentation for regulatory submissions.

Environmental Risk – Mitigation Strategies

Mitigation: Identifying potential environmental risks and implementing strategies to minimize their impact is a core component of compliance.

By proactively assessing vulnerabilities and deploying appropriate controls, organizations can reduce the likelihood of non-compliance incidents.

Frequently asked questions

What is environmental compliance?

Environmental compliance refers to adhering to regulations and standards set by government agencies to protect the environment. It’s a critical process involving monitoring, reporting, and mitigation strategies.

How does AI contribute to environmental compliance?

Artificial intelligence is used in environmental compliance through automated systems that monitor operations, analyze data for potential issues, and generate accurate reports, improving efficiency and reducing the risk of human error.

Why is environmental compliance important for organizations?

Environmental compliance protects the environment, avoids costly fines and legal penalties, and helps maintain a positive reputation with stakeholders – demonstrating a commitment to sustainability.
